When was The Phoenix Theatre & Arts Centre registered as a charity?
The Phoenix Theatre & Arts Centre was registered with the Charity Commission for England and Wales on 3 May 2016 as charity number 1166858. It has been registered for 10 years.
Who runs The Phoenix Theatre & Arts Centre?
The Phoenix Theatre & Arts Centre is governed by a board of 7 trustees. The chair of trustees is Eric Wayne Clifford. Trustees are legally responsible for the charity's governance and are listed in full on its profile.
Where does The Phoenix Theatre & Arts Centre operate?
The Phoenix Theatre & Arts Centre operates in Hampshire, as recorded in its Charity Commission filing.
